Obtaining aldehydes by oxidation of alcohols. They say that if you heat a test tube with methyl alcohol and potassium permanganate, then, as formaldehyde is formed, the purple color of the solution will disappear. Why?

When heated, potassium permanganate decomposes with the release of oxygen, which oxidizes methanol. This produces formaldehyde and water. The purple color of the solution is due to the presence of potassium permanganate KMnO4 (more precisely, MnO4- ions). The decomposition of potassium permanganate produces potassium manganate (K2MnO4), manganese oxide and oxygen. Ions MnO4 / 2 – do not color the solution in violet. Those. the number of ions that colored the solution is reduced, therefore the color disappears.
